Hello, On Mon, 2026-03-02 at 15:15 +0100, Juri Lelli wrote: > > diff --git a/kernel/sched/core.c b/kernel/sched/core.c > > index 4ca79ff58fca..b5bb2eb112bf 100644 > > --- a/kernel/sched/core.c > > +++ b/kernel/sched/core.c > > @@ -124,6 +124,10 @@ EXPORT_TRACEPOINT_SYMBOL_GPL(sched_exit_tp); > > EXPORT_TRACEPOINT_SYMBOL_GPL(sched_set_need_resched_tp); > > EXPORT_TRACEPOINT_SYMBOL_GPL(sched_enqueue_tp); > > EXPORT_TRACEPOINT_SYMBOL_GPL(sched_dequeue_tp); > > +EXPORT_TRACEPOINT_SYMBOL_GPL(sched_dl_throttle_tp); > > +EXPORT_TRACEPOINT_SYMBOL_GPL(sched_dl_replenish_tp); > > +EXPORT_TRACEPOINT_SYMBOL_GPL(sched_dl_server_start_tp); > > +EXPORT_TRACEPOINT_SYMBOL_GPL(sched_dl_server_stop_tp); > > Don't we need to export sched_dl_update_tp as well?
Right, we do. > > > DEFINE_PER_CPU_SHARED_ALIGNED(struct rq, runqueues); > > DEFINE_PER_CPU(struct rnd_state, sched_rnd_state); > > ... > > > @@ -1532,7 +1551,8 @@ static void update_curr_dl_se(struct rq *rq, struct > > sched_dl_entity *dl_se, s64 > > > > if (!is_leftmost(dl_se, &rq->dl)) > > resched_curr(rq); > > - } > > + } else > > + trace_sched_dl_update_tp(dl_se, cpu_of(rq), > > dl_get_type(dl_se, rq)); > > This wants braces even if it's a single statement. Alright, will fix. Thanks, Gabriele
